Applications
It is applied in the abstraction of the ɑ-H atom of alcohols and their O-substituted derivatives results in oxidation to the ketones and in the oxidation of TMS ethers to ketones, secondary alcohols to ketones, and secondary diols to ɑ-hydroxy ketones. It is applied as a reactant involved in the synthesis of substituted dihydroazulene photo switches, carbene-based Lewis pairs for hydrogen activation, 1,3-Dipolar cycloaddition reactions for preparation of α-amino-β-hydroxy esters, oxidation of allenic compounds, Mukaiyama aldol addition reactions and ionic hydrogenation as a counteranion and ligand source.

Solubility
Insoluble in water. Soluble in methanol.

Notes
Moisture sensitive. Store away from bases, water/moisture, heat and oxidizing agents. Keep the container tightly closed and place it in a cool, dry and well ventilated condition. Store under inert gas. Keep it refrigerated.
